Output d9b631a852d58564749fe455d9c864fb4fc4f185bd9631995f94f1127b0cbb07:909

value
17728
script pubkey
OP_0 OP_PUSHBYTES_20 5fadae3cf562173da3d15805fe94d31d96b5d1c5
address
bc1qt7k6u084vgtnmg73tqzla9xnrkttt5w93czxh0
transaction
d9b631a852d58564749fe455d9c864fb4fc4f185bd9631995f94f1127b0cbb07
confirmations
201613
spent
true